Mae works hard, making little money, but is satisfied with her little slice of life. She gathers subpoenaed documents while admiring the hot night janitor from afar. It's not a glamorous life, but it's hers.
Will, a Marine, is home for good, just trying to figure out where he wants to go next. He's sweeping floors, emptying trash, and watching the woman on the third floor who works late too much.
When an explosion at work thrusts them together, they try desperately to navigate the sudden complications, while being
thrown into the public eye.
Suddenly, he gets a promotion and a girlfriend practically at once. He feels like his life is gaining direction. Then all hell breaks loose. Mae is thrust into danger again, this time at the hands of someone Will never thought he'd meet.
**
Previously published as Mae Day by Anne Conley for Susan Stoker's Aces Press, this is rewritten for Melinda Owens' series, Unknown Ops.
